How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Egmont Tenants?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Egmont Tenants Studio Apartments | $2,483 | $1,775 | $5,670 |
| Egmont Tenants 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,111 | $1,000 | $8,035 |
| Egmont Tenants 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,821 | $2,375 | $10,000+ |
| Egmont Tenants 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,577 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
| Egmont Tenants 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,398 | $1,996 | $10,000+ |
| Egmont Tenants 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,434 | $1,250 | $9,000 |
| Egmont Tenants 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,753 | $4,100 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Egmont Tenants
How much are Studio apartments in Egmont Tenants?
There are currently 484 Studio Apartments in Egmont Tenants with rent ranges from $1,775 to $5,670 with an average price of $2,483.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Egmont Tenants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Egmont Tenants ranges from $1,000 to $8,035 with an average monthly rent of $3,111.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Egmont Tenants c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Egmont Tenants range from $2,375 to $11,623.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,821.
How expensive are Egmont Tenants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 533 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Egmont Tenants on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,050 to $17,193 - averaging $4,577 for the location.
